Effects of LNG exports on the U.S. natural gas market

During the first half of 2022 U.S. LNG exports averaged nearly 11.2 billion cubic feet per day (Bcf/d), about 12% of the dry natural gas produced in the United States. But these exports have an impact on the domestic gas market. To explore the effects of future U.S. LNG export volumes on domestic natural gas prices, this report examines a range of potential LNG price and investment drivers.
